本文鏈接: https://www.cnblogs.com/hubaijia/p/about-exceptions-1.html 系列文章: 關於Exception的幾點思考和在項目中的使用(一) 關於Exception的幾點思考和在項目中的使用(二) 關於Exception ...
本文鏈接: https: www.cnblogs.com hubaijia p about exceptions .html 系列文章: 關於Exception的幾點思考和在項目中的使用 一 關於Exception的幾點思考和在項目中的使用 二 關於Exception的幾點思考和在項目中的使用 三 本文目錄 目錄 與Exception相關的文件結構 ExceptionFactory 和 Ensur ...
2021-04-10 23:21 0 507 推薦指數:
本文鏈接: https://www.cnblogs.com/hubaijia/p/about-exceptions-1.html 系列文章: 關於Exception的幾點思考和在項目中的使用(一) 關於Exception的幾點思考和在項目中的使用(二) 關於Exception ...
本文鏈接: https://www.cnblogs.com/hubaijia/p/about-exceptions-3.html 系列文章: 關於Exception的幾點思考和在項目中的使用(一) 關於Exception的幾點思考和在項目中的使用(二) 關於Exception ...
伴隨着微服務框架的流行,SpringCloud項目也變得越來越龐大,由於它是由諸多子項目組成,為了更好管理SpringCloud的發布版本與各個子項目的版本關系,SpringCloud采用了一種新的版本規則來控制整個SpringCloud的版本發布。先來了解下SpringCloud的幾個相關 ...
1.1 為什么有這篇博客 1.博客說明 1.在做celery異步任務和定時任務時,有些人使用django-celery+django-redis+celery+redis+django-celery-beat實現 2.但是這種實現方法和django結合過於緊密 ...
為什么要使用分布式架構?分布式架構解決了互聯網應用的兩大難題:高並發和高可用。高並發指服務器並發處理客戶端請求的數量大,而高可用指后端服務能始終處於可用狀態。 關於高並發,單機所能提供的並發量總是有限的。其受限於網絡帶寬、單機內存、CPU等。舉個例子,假如單機需要10000並發請求,每次 ...
項目中service類成為上帝類,所有工作都在一個類中完成已經成為了一個相當棘手的問題。這樣的高耦合場景使得代碼難以維護,難以閱讀,在需求變更時修改起來極為不方便,幾乎是每一次變更就需要重構。 學習設計模式可以嘗試在項目中降低耦合,抽象業務場景,從而使得項目更好的擴展和維護。 策略模式 ...
1,其實有時候一直在找借口不去思考這個問題,總是以趕項目為由,沒有很認真的思考這個問題,為什么我們要在項目中使用MVP模式,自己也用MVP也已經做了兩個項目,而且在網上也看了不少的文章,但是感覺在高層次的思想上還是沒有去理解它,都是泛泛而談的“解耦”、“擴展”的字眼,作為一個初中級開發者,我需要 ...
1、創建.net core web程序並運行 2、在Consul中注冊該服務 Consul支持兩種服務注冊的方式,一種是通過Consul的服務注冊HTTP API,由服務自身在啟動后調用API注冊自己,另外一種則是通過在配置文件中定義服務的方式進行注冊。Consul文檔中建議使用 ...